== English == === Alternative forms === a-row === Etymology === From a- +‎ row. === Pronunciation === IPA(key): /əˈɹoʊ/ Rhymes: -əʊ === Adverb === arow (not comparable) In a row, line, or rank; successively. , Number 10 “Of Turning,” ¶ 8, p. 184,[1] And in the middle of the Breadth of the Cross-Greddle is made several holes all arow to receive the Iron Pin set upright in the Treddle. === References === “arow”, in Webster’s Revised Unabridged Dictionary, Springfield, Mass.: G. & C. Merriam, 1913, →OCLC. === Anagrams === WORA == Middle English == === Noun === arow alternative form of arwe
